Chicago’s History and Culture

Chicago began as a trading post, established by French settlers in 1795. In the early 1800s, the city experienced rapid growth due to its strategic location on the Great Lakes and the Illinois & Michigan Canal. By mid-century, Chicago was becoming an industrial powerhouse, with its manufacturing and transportation industries leading the way. The city’s population swelled as immigrants from Europe and other parts of the United States moved to the city in search of work. By 1900, Chicago had become the second-largest city in the United States, surpassed only by New York City.

In the decades since, Chicago has become an international center of culture and commerce. Its many universities, theaters, galleries, and libraries are reminders of the city’s long and proud history of intellectualism and innovation. In addition to its cultural attractions, Chicago boasts some of the most iconic architectural wonders in the world, from the iconic Willis Tower to the stunning Art Deco buildings on Michigan Avenue. Chicago is also home to some of the world’s best dining, shopping, and nightlife scenes.

Exploring the Loop

The Loop is Chicago’s downtown area, home to some of the city’s most iconic attractions. Take a stroll down Michigan Avenue and take in the stunning Art Deco buildings that line the street. Visit one of the many world-class museums, such as the Art Institute of Chicago or the Field Museum of Natural History. Spend an afternoon at Millennium Park, home to Cloud Gate (the “Bean”) and Lurie Garden. Or visit one of the many theaters or music venues in the Loop for a night out on the town.

Touring Navy Pier

Navy Pier is a popular tourist spot located along Lake Michigan. It’s home to a variety of attractions, including the Children’s Museum, IMAX Theatre, and Shakespeare Theatre. Take a ride on one of the historic ferris wheels or take in a show at one of the many theaters located on Navy Pier. The pier also offers plenty of restaurants and shops for visitors to explore.

Touring Local Breweries

Chicago’s craft beer scene is booming, with plenty of local breweries offering tours and tastings. Take a tour of Goose Island Brewery or Revolution Brewing to learn all about beer-making and sample some delicious craft beers.
